The Hydro Dynamic pool competition is held in the suburbs of Vienna, central to many European countries. BSFZ Südstadt’s pool in Maria Enzersdorf allows nearly 50 athletes to compete in a shallow 31°C (87.8°F) pool for STA and a 50m pool with a constant depth of 2m for DNF, DYN, and DYNB. The world-record-status competition also serves as the Austrian Championship for DYN and DYNB.
